Fireworks in the Heavens

Matthew J. Lucio joins Michael as a guest co-host to talk about how Adventist missionaries in Nanking barely escaped the onset of the Chinese civil war in 1927. What? 3. Fake Ellen White: Margaret Rowen and the Prophet's Mantle

Drs. Michael Campbell and Gregory Howell talk about Margaret Rowen, a woman who claimed to be the prophetic successor to Ellen White, and why so many Adventists were willing to believe her. They also share some newly discovered resources which help shed light on what Rowen really taught. Also, there's (attempted) murder.
